So I've got an off-the-wall question: how do you manage colds or getting sick? Would you run anyway with a cold? and how long after something more wretched--like the flu, for example? The reason I'm asking is that I got my son's cold.... : (

Oldfloss profile image
OldflossAdministrator in reply to LiisaM

The general rule..above the neck...fine..as long as you dan breathe easily..below the neck and on the chest, no.

Flu.. true flu..you need to fully recover and then take a week to recuperate and feel really well.

If you are on antibiotics you don't run until you gave finished the course:)

Realfoodieclub profile image
Realfoodieclub in reply to LiisaM

For me, If I feel a cold coming on, I dial it all down a notch, mainly because I have gone out with a slight cold pushed myself on a run and next day sore throat, runny nose the lot rather than just a sniffle. I find just taking it easy for a week (walking only sometimes). I can just pick up the pace the next week. I hope it goes soon for you, Rfc x
